ABSTRACT:
The present invention provides a light-emitting diode-converted phosphor compound having the following chemical formula:in-line-formulae description="In-line Formulae" end="lead"?(M1-m-nCemEun)2BO3Xin-line-formulae description="In-line Formulae" end="tail"?wherein M is at least one element selected from the group consisting of Ca, Sr and Ba, X is at least one element selected from the group consisting of Cl and Br, 0≦m≦0.5, and 0≦n≦0.5.
